Michelin Pilot Powers
Yes the 190 will fiton the same width wheel(5.5 inch). However, I wouldn't recommend it if you enjoy turning more than drag racing. The 180/55 has a larger contact patch than a 190/50forturning. Reason being, it has a taller profile so there's technically more rubber to use in leaning/turning. A taller profile gives you better steering quickness as well. And yes the Pilot Power 2CT(2Compound Technology IIRC)is a great tire but unless you're going to the track, I'd just go with the regular Pilot Power and save a few bucks. You'll still love the regular Pilot Power. I know I do..
